The TK1 runs on 12 volts (and can work down to 9.6 volts). A straightforward connection from a normal pair of Wago connections on the PDP through an appropriately-sized barrel connector seems to me like it would be fine.
Wouldn't it be a really good idea to add a buck-boost convertor before it? This way, those pesky voltage spikes and drops won't do anything to it. The voltage in batteries can easily dip below 9.6v during competitive maneuvers! It's just about timing when all the motors turn on on the robot at the same time ;).
If it draws less than 2 amps 1.5 amps, you can run it through the Voltage Regulator Module.
